TL;DR Summary

Warren Buffett has reduced his stake in Apple and other stocks, resulting in a $97 billion gain for Berkshire Hathaway, raising its cash reserves to $325 billion. This move has sparked speculation among analysts about Buffett's motives, with theories ranging from adhering to value investing principles to preparing for a potential crisis or succession planning. Despite the cash buildup, Buffett has not been actively pursuing major acquisitions or providing capital to large US businesses.
